London uses British pounds and in Amsterdam and Florence they use Euros. If you have an ATM card with a 4 numeral pin that does not start with a zero you should be able to usr that to get what you nedd. Call your bank and tell them you will be traveling.

For London, buy a one-day Travelcard for zones 1-6. This will take care of all your transport. You can probably get away without any cash if all you buy is the ticket, food, and souvenirs. Use a credit card for purchases and a debit or ATM card for cash if necessary.

I would ride the Tube to Piccadilly Circus and get on the #15 bus (the old double-deckers) and ride to Tower Hill, then the RV1 down the south bank. Here's a map of the bus and Tube routes that connect the major sights:
